實現(xiàn)真正10G性能

  從誕生之日起,用戶就希望10G以太網(wǎng)在將性能提高十倍的同時,能保持與10/100/1000Mbps以太網(wǎng)的向后兼容性和全面的互操作性。



  在802.3ae標準中,獲得十倍的性能提升并不像看起來那樣簡單。10/100/1000Mbps與10G以太網(wǎng)MAC層之間存在的一項關(guān)鍵差異,影響到10G以太網(wǎng)接口提供10Gbps的線速性能。802.3ae標準的制訂者詳細說明了三種解決這個問題的方式。




  10G以太網(wǎng)MAC內(nèi)部的關(guān)鍵差異



  在10/100和千兆以太網(wǎng)中,MAC層以線性方式運行,數(shù)據(jù)串行進入和離開MAC層,所有的數(shù)據(jù)都具有嵌入在數(shù)據(jù)流內(nèi)部的起始與結(jié)束控制信息(包括計時和同步信息)。10G以太網(wǎng)的MAC層則要復(fù)雜得多。



  為取得10Gbps的寬帶速率,IEEE改變了MAC層解釋信令的方式。10G以太網(wǎng)MAC層在解釋數(shù)據(jù)時并行運行,而非生成串行流。每條傳輸與接收路徑都由四條數(shù)據(jù)通道構(gòu)成,被分割為字節(jié)的數(shù)據(jù)流以循環(huán)方式分配到編號為0到3的四條通道上。



  以太網(wǎng)幀具有明確定義的起始與結(jié)束邊界,即分隔符。這些邊界由特殊字符和一個指示數(shù)據(jù)包之間最小間隔量或空閑時間的12字節(jié)長度的包間縫隙(IPG)標記。由于10G以太網(wǎng)MAC層的并行本質(zhì),預(yù)測前一個數(shù)據(jù)流的結(jié)束字節(jié)落入到哪條通道中是不可能的。這使得找到起始位(保持計時和同步的必要條件)更加困難。802.3ae標準規(guī)定了一個絕妙的解決辦法:“起始控制字符”,即新數(shù)據(jù)幀的每一個字節(jié),必須對準“通道0”。但是,這個解決辦法使MAC處理IPG的方法變得復(fù)雜,從而直接影響到性能。IEEE為廠商提供了以下三種解決方式。



  增加IPG的填充



  如果前一個包的結(jié)束字符落入到12字節(jié)IPG的第12個縫隙中,那么MAC層什么都不做,保持12字節(jié)的最小IPG,下一個包的起始字符自動對準“通道0”的位置A。但是,如果前一個包的結(jié)束字符落在其他位置上,MAC層必須分別向IPG添加字節(jié),以保證下一個包的起始字符恰好對準“通道0”的位置A。這種作法導(dǎo)致了長度范圍為12到15字節(jié)的最小IPG(最小12字節(jié)加額外的填充)。



  縮減IPG



  在向IPG填充字節(jié)、保證起始字符對準位置A后,MAC刪除中間列的空閑字符。這種作法導(dǎo)致長度范圍從8到11字節(jié)的IPG。通過刪除中間列的空閑字符減少10G以太網(wǎng)IPG,可將10G以太網(wǎng)鏈路上的可用帶寬根據(jù)包長度最多增加5%。



  平均IPG



  這種選擇采用前兩種方式的組合,并增加了一個虧損額空閑計數(shù)器。后者跟蹤記錄增加的或刪除的空閑字節(jié)的數(shù)量。在某些情況下,MAC層將添加字節(jié),在另一些情況下,刪除字節(jié)。經(jīng)過一段相當長時間后,最終結(jié)果將是平均的12字節(jié)最小10G以太網(wǎng)IPG。平均10G以太網(wǎng)IPG保證了10G以太網(wǎng)提供100%的可用寬帶,使連接保持零損失線速性能。



摘自《網(wǎng)絡(luò)通信》

   

微信掃描分享本文到朋友圈
掃碼關(guān)注5G通信官方公眾號,免費領(lǐng)取以下5G精品資料
  • 1、回復(fù)“YD5GAI”免費領(lǐng)取《中國移動:5G網(wǎng)絡(luò)AI應(yīng)用典型場景技術(shù)解決方案白皮書
  • 2、回復(fù)“5G6G”免費領(lǐng)取《5G_6G毫米波測試技術(shù)白皮書-2022_03-21
  • 3、回復(fù)“YD6G”免費領(lǐng)取《中國移動:6G至簡無線接入網(wǎng)白皮書
  • 4、回復(fù)“LTBPS”免費領(lǐng)取《《中國聯(lián)通5G終端白皮書》
  • 5、回復(fù)“ZGDX”免費領(lǐng)取《中國電信5GNTN技術(shù)白皮書
  • 6、回復(fù)“TXSB”免費領(lǐng)取《通信設(shè)備安裝工程施工工藝圖解
  • 7、回復(fù)“YDSL”免費領(lǐng)取《中國移動算力并網(wǎng)白皮書
  • 8、回復(fù)“5GX3”免費領(lǐng)取《R1623501-g605G的系統(tǒng)架構(gòu)1
  • 本周熱點本月熱點

     

      最熱通信招聘

      最新招聘信息